Homemade BBQ Sauce Recipe

Easy Homemade BBQ Sauce Recipe, in a jar with a spoon. Make ahead for quick meals!

This Homemade BBQ Sauce Recipe is quick and easy to make with simple ingredients. This barbecue sauce is a little spicy, slightly sweet and perfectly tangy!
 Prep Time5 mins
 Cook Time10 mins
 Total Time15 mins
 Calories111kcal

Ingredients

  • 6 ounce can tomato paste
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 1/4 cup honey or brown sugar
  • 1/4 cup ap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ons molasses
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per optional, for extra spice

Instructions

  • Combine all ingredients in a small saucepan. Bring to simmer over medium heat, whisking, and then reduce heat. Simmer 5-10 minutes to blend and develop the flavors, stirring often.
  • Add more water to thin the barbecue sauce if it is too thick.

Notes

  • Store BBQ sauce for up to 2 weeks in the refrigerator or up to 3 months in the freezer.
